Potatoes Chunk is a versatile dish made from diced or cubed potatoes, often seasoned and cooked by roasting, frying, or boiling. With origins rooted in global cuisine, potatoes are a staple food found across cultures, from creamy European recipes to spiced variations in South Asia. Packed with essential nutrients like vitamin C, potassium, and dietary fiber, potatoes are an energy-rich carbohydrate that supports heart health and digestion when consumed in moderation. Their skins provide additional fiber, while preparation methods like frying may increase calories and fat content. Potatoes Chunk can be customized with herbs, spices, or toppings, making it a delicious and adaptable option for meals. Whether featured as a side dish or a hearty main, this classic preparation balances simplicity with nutritional potential. Remember to watch portion sizes and opt for healthier cooking methods, such as baking or steaming, to maximize their benefits while minimizing excess fats or sodium.
